I have to get my OH from central london to Straford upon Avon in a short period of time (about 3.5 hours).

He is in London for the day and has an Oyster Card, so we were thinking the the best option will be for him to get on the tube and go to a outter london staion where I pick him up in the car and drive him up to Stratford (where we will both be staying).

I will be coming down via the M1, but the key ios the speed getting him up to Stratfor, he will leave LOndion at about 5.30 pm and we need to be Stratford about 8.30 - 9, allowing for traffic where would be the best place to pick him up for the shortest/fastest journey up. I know a lot of London, but not the west side, any advice would be appriciated.

    Hillingdon is I think better than Uxbridge if you are coming by car - it's straight off the A40. On the same line.
